Here is a typical late Victorian Officer's large . 450 cal revolver by WILLIAM TRANTER, complete with the Officer's name and Regiment that comes with it's leather holster, Sam Browne belt, cross strap and and leather sword frog. The revolver still retains much of its private purchase high blue finish and the top flat of the barrel still retains the Supplier's name and address: COGSWELL & HARRISON, 192 NEW BOND STREET
